摘要
Studies conducted in Ethiopia and elsewhere confirm that the Small-Medium Enterprises (SMEs) sector has the potential contributions to the economic growth, employment generation and poverty alleviation. However, The Small-Medium enterprises (SMEs) sector in Ethiopia faces a number of constraints that hinder its rapid growth and development and therefore reduces the weight of its potential contribution to the national economy, and inhibits the economic empowerment of women. This study shows in a model the influential factors of women job involvement in SNNPRS of Ethiopia referring to SME in specific, and from the analysis some proposals are suggested for increasing Ethiopian Women job involvement.
